The President of the United States of America takes pleasure in presenting the Navy Cross to Gunner Thomas M. Stoops, United States Navy, for extraordinary heroism and devotion to duty while serving as Gunner on board the Aircraft Carrier U.S.S. FRANKLIN (CV-13), which was striking the Japanese home islands in the vicinity of Kobe, Japan, on 19 March 1945. When the FRANKLIN was struck by enemy bombs which caused tremendous fires and explosions among a large number of fully armed and fueled planes both on the flight deck and in the hangar, Gunner Stoops organized firefighting and damage control parties, jettisoning hot ammunition and bombs, some of which were extricated from amidst the wreckage of burning aircraft and were so heated and damaged it was impossible to defuse them. The conduct of Lieutenant Commander Stoops throughout this action reflects great credit upon himself, and was in keeping with the highest traditions of the United States Naval Service.
